, a mechanical engineer and rock hound.Terzaghi likewise created the framework for concepts of bearing capability of foundations, and the theory for forecast of the price of negotiation of clay layers because of debt consolidation. Afterwards, Maurice Biot totally developed the three-dimensional soil consolidation theory, expanding the one-dimensional model formerly created by Terzaghi to more general hypotheses and introducing the collection of basic formulas of Poroelasticity.
Geotechnical engineers examine and establish the properties of subsurface conditions and materials. They also develop matching earthworks and keeping frameworks, passages, and framework structures, and might manage and review websites, which might additionally entail website tracking along with the threat analysis and mitigation of all-natural dangers. Geotechnical designers and design rock hounds carry out geotechnical examinations to obtain info on the physical homes of dirt and rock hidden and adjacent to a site to make earthworks and foundations for recommended frameworks and for the repair of distress to earthworks and structures brought on by subsurface conditions.

If the interface in between the mass and the base of an incline has an intricate geometry, slope security evaluation is challenging and mathematical service techniques are required. Commonly, the user interface's specific geometry is unknown, and a simplified user interface geometry is thought. Finite inclines need three-dimensional versions to be analyzed, so most slopes are assessed presuming that they are considerably large and can be stood for by two-dimensional designs.

Engineering the homes and auto mechanics of rocks consisting of the application of dynamics, fluid technicians, kinematics and product mechanics. This unites geology, soil and rock technicians, and architectural design for the layout and construction of structures for a variety of civil engineering projects. This area includes anticipating the performance of structure soil and rock to a load enforced by a structure, while taking into consideration efficiency, economic climate and security.

A geologist would certainly need to re-train to become a geotechnical engineer, although there is lots of cross-over between both careers, which can make this simpler. Rock hounds require to have an understanding of soils, rocks and other products from a clinical point of view, while geotechnical designers tale their understanding of matters such as dirt and rock technician, geophysics and hydrology and apply them to design and ecological jobs.
When starting out, these engineers will certainly often tend to deal with less complicated jobs, accumulating knowledge and experience prepared for more challenging work later. Geotechnical engineers tend to specialise in details locations as they grow in experience, concentrating on specific frameworks such as trains, roadways or water. These engineers also work with sustainable energy, offshore and onshore oil and gas, nuclear power, and a lot more.
